Venetian Marble Pierced Work Altar Frontal
Period: 1300-1500
Origin: Italy
Medium: Marble
Literature: This marble panel illustrates a characteristically Venetian amalgam of Byzantine details within a gothic architectural framework. By the end of the 13th century Venice had adopted a cosmopolitan Mediterranean architectural imagery with various European, and a few Islamic elements, blended into ecclesiastical decoration in a unique and creative manner.
